Firework devices have become an thrilling part of live concerts, introducing a spectacular element that improves the overall experience for audience members. These systems include fireworks, sparkler displays, and other special effects that create sight stimulus and energy during shows. Concert organizers collaborate closely with certified firework experts to ensure that these features are secure and well-coordinated with the music. This partnership is crucial because security is a top priority when using any form of fireworks, especially in crowded venues.

However, go the application of firework devices is not without its challenges. Concert organizers must adhere to rigorous rules and standards to ensure safety. This includes obtaining the necessary licenses and conducting comprehensive risk assessments before the event. Additionally, they must consider the venue's specific limitations, such as closeness to combustible materials and the layout of the audience area. Proper instruction and readiness are crucial for the pyrotechnicians who operate these devices to minimize any potential risks and ensure a secure environment for everyone involved.
